Button expects interesting weekend in Valencia

Wednesday, August 19, 2009

Formula 1 championship leader Jenson Button is looking forward to get back in the car following the four week summer break. The Brawn GP driver is expecting the top drivers to be extremely close at this weekend's European Grand Prix.

"It's going to be great to get back racing again after the summer break and everyone at the team is looking forward to Valencia," Button said. "I've kept pretty busy over the past few weeks with the London Triathlon at the start of the month and then some time to relax with my family and friends but it's seemed like a long time without a race! Valencia is a beautiful city and the track is quite fun when it goes round the edge of the marina and over the bridge. It's quite challenging for the drivers with so many turns and the added factor of being surrounded by barriers means you have to maintain your concentration.

"There's been a lot of work going on at the factory following our shutdown and with the cars at the front being so close at the moment, it will be an interesting weekend."
